SUPER U / EREVAN
Read moreThis is the largest supermarket in Cotonou (4,000 sq.m.) which has taken up residence in the Erevan shopping center which covers more than 13,000 sq.m. (where there is also a Samsung store, a Casa Del Papa counter, a branch of the Sonaec bookstore, a snack bar, telephone stores, lighting stores, etc.). At the Super U, you will find all the French products that you would expect from the chain. But also a lot of Beninese products since the supermarket works for the valorization of local productions by putting them forward.
LA FEUILLE DE VIGNE
Read moreThis air-conditioned wine cellar is an excellent address for those who are a little nostalgic for French labels. You can find great vintages and French wines, of course, but also some sweet Chilean, Portuguese, Californian, South African beverages... There are also some (very) good bottles of champagne and whisky in particular. In any case, it is undoubtedly one of the best cellars in the country. And especially one of the biggest with hundreds of labels for sale to the general public. Cheers!

SOBEBRA
Read moreFor 30 years, SOBEBRA has been at the heart of the Beninese agri-food landscape. A major economic, social and eco-citizen player, the company is one of the largest private national contributors and employs nearly 1000 people.
Proudly Beninese, SOBEBRA has concerns that go far beyond its industrial success. For several years, the company has been committed to sustainable development in Benin and to the well-being of the community. This commitment is also part of a well-understood growth logic: the sustainability of SOBEBRA can only be envisaged in close interdependence with that of its "ecosystem". It is to better serve these causes that SOBEBRA has voluntarily put in place a policy of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R). This means not only fully respecting the regulations in force, but also going beyond them and investing more in human capital, in the environment and in the relations with the stakeholders.
